What to expect
Tours in Busan usually combine city sightseeing with coastal scenery, local neighbourhoods and cultural stops. They suit travellers who want guided context and easy logistics—great for first-time visitors, groups and anyone who prefers a structured day over independent exploring.
How to choose
Pricing for tours in Busan is fairly predictable, with a moderate band between the lower and upper quartiles. The entry-level options typically cover basic guided sightseeing and shared transport, while the higher end offers smaller groups, more specialised themes or added comforts; if you want certainty pick mid-range options, but there is genuine choice at both ends.
When to go
The busiest month is March, when demand is notably higher and availability can be tighter with a livelier atmosphere. The quietest month is January, when bookings drop and tours feel much calmer and easier to book. If avoiding crowds matters most, plan for January when tours are least busy.
